Transaction 577e91836acda02f1c74870af926e17f3d76c9b8d52018cb75205abd13397926
1 Input
1 Output
-
577e91836acda02f1c74870af926e17f3d76c9b8d52018cb75205abd13397926:0
- value
- 474467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10c35a1aec0f237bb7a5dea611a2cb12d3a8de9b OP_EQUAL
- address
- 33DekuWNrvaFDeuAbKdkgTDZRhcEYAZM3T